			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Many of you did not upgrade from Windows XP to Windows Vista, but are planning to upgrade to Windows 7. How dare you leave the Microsoft upgrade path? As a punishment, you can&#8217;t upgrade directly from XP to 7; you have to do what&#8217;s called a clean install, which means you have to jump through some hoops to keep your old data and programs.</p>
<p>Not to worry, <a href="http://cnettv.cnet.com/upgrade-windows-xp-windows-7/9742-1_53-50078260.html">we&#8217;ll show you</a> a couple ways to deal with the pain of installing Windows 7 on your XP machine. And afterward, Microsoft will forgive you your trespasses. Maybe.</p>
<p>Before you start, do these three things.</p>
<p>1. Run the <a href="http://www.microsoft.com/downloads/details.aspx?displaylang=en&amp;FamilyID=1b544e90-7659-4bd9-9e51-2497c146af15">Windows 7 upgrade adviser</a>. It will let you know if your computer can handle any version of Windows 7.</p>
<p>2. Check the <a href="http://www.microsoft.com/windows/compatibility/windows-7/partner/default.aspx">Windows 7 compatibility center</a>. This is different than the upgrade adviser. It will tell you if you need to update your drivers or apps to make them work in 7.</p>
<p>3. Make a copy of your hard drive, just in case things go horribly wrong.  I recommend using Macrium Reflect; it&#8217;s a free download available from Download.com.</p>
<p>OK, now you&#8217;re ready to upgrade.</p>
